Full leather was standard on all S3s - Alcantara was just a no cost option...

Here is the full option list minus VAT from the 2003 MY:

Acoustic Parking 7X1 297.87
Auto Dip Rear View Mirror 4L6 125.11
Bose Sound System 8RY 425.53
CD Changer 7A2 340.42
Cruise Control 8T2 277.45
Front Armrest - Storage Box 6E3 91.06
Front Armrest - Cup Holders 6E6 125.10
Front Armrest - Cassette Box6E1 152.33
Heated Front Seats 4A3 302.13
Luggage Net 6M2 62.98
Mobile Phone Prep 9ZF 339.57
Polished Alloy Mirrors 6FC 204.25
Radio - NEW Concert Upgrade 8UD 170.21
Radio - NEW Symphony Upgrade8UM 225.53
Rear Headrest/3 Point Belt PKA 74.04
Sat Nav Plus System PNB 1,851.06
Sat Nav System PNH 1,106.38
Sideguard Airbag System 4X3 400.00
Steering Wheel 4 Spoke PZ1 123.40
Sunroof 3FE 681.70
TV Option for Plus QV1 600.00
Pearl or Metallic Paint: 370.21
8Jx18" 9 Spoke "RS4" wheels PQR 1,276.60
Lowered Suspension PQZ 382.97

There was also a hideable tow bar option but thats not in my list...
